欧美一区二区三区,国内熟女精品熟女A片视频小说,日本av网,小鲜肉男男GAY做受XXX网站

css背景色透明div恢復

劉若蘭1年前6瀏覽0評論

CSS是Web設計中不可或缺的一部分,它可以控制網頁的外觀和樣式。在實際的網頁設計中,經常會使用透明背景的div元素來制作懸浮窗口、下拉菜單等效果。但是,有時候這些div元素在滾動頁面或者進行其他操作后會出現背景色變深或者消失的問題,這給我們的設計帶來了很大的困擾。

針對這個問題,我們可以使用一些簡單的CSS樣式來解決。首先,我們需要在CSS中為透明的div元素設置背景色。

.transparent {
background-color: rgba(0,0,0,0.5);
}

在上面的代碼中,我們使用rgba格式來設置背景色,其中最后一個參數0.5表示透明度為50%。如果需要改變透明度,只需修改最后一個參數即可。

但是,即使設置了背景色,div元素在進行某些操作后仍然會出現背景色變深或者消失的問題。這是因為瀏覽器會將透明的div元素與其他元素疊加在一起顯示,導致元素的層級關系不正確。為此,我們需要為div元素設置z-index樣式,使其在頁面中處于較高的層級。

.transparent {
position: absolute;
top: 0;
left: 0;
z-index: 999;
}

在上面的代碼中,我們為透明的div元素設置了position:absolute樣式,將其定位到頁面的最上層。并且,我們設置了z-index樣式為999,使其處于較高的層級。這樣就可以保證透明的div元素在頁面中始終處于較高的層級,避免了與其他元素疊加導致的問題。

綜上所述,為透明的div元素設置背景色并設置z-index樣式,可以有效解決透明背景的div元素在進行某些操作后出現背景色變深或者消失的問題。